Design Strategies to Maximize Natural Light
Bringing more light into your home starts with intentional design. At CIH Design, a common technique is the use of large windows and sliding glass doors, which provide seamless transitions between indoor and outdoor spaces. Skylights are also an effective choice, letting sunlight enter from above and creating an uplifting atmosphere from morning to night. Adding glass doors to patios or lanais can open up the house not only to the sunlight, but also to Maui’s lovely breezes.
To boost natural light, arrange furniture so it does not block sunbeams. Using light-colored walls and reflective surfaces such as mirrors can help distribute light around the room, enhancing brightness. Including plants adds texture and color without interfering with the flow of light. Incorporating light, airy materials for window treatments, such as sheer curtains, helps diffuse and soften the amount of sunlight entering different rooms. Applying these strategies, homeowners can enjoy bright, airy spaces that improve both comfort and style.
Many CIH Design projects in Maui incorporate custom-designed window walls, folding glass panels, and clerestory windows for filtered daylight and privacy, while still welcoming the island landscape inside. By considering the placement of windows and glass features in each phase of the design process, homes benefit from optimized sightlines and optimal sun exposure during every season.
